Román Quevedo Reina is an Assistant Professor in the Department of Civil Engineering at Universidad de Las Palmas de Gran Canaria (ULPGC). He is affiliated with GIR SIANI: Mechanics of Continuum Media and Structures and IU Intelligent Systems and Numerical Applications. His research focuses on computational mechanics and structural engineering with particular emphasis on offshore wind energy infrastructure.
Dr. Quevedo Reina's research interests center on the structural analysis and optimization of offshore wind turbine foundations, particularly jacket and monopile structures. His work integrates computational mechanics with artificial intelligence techniques, especially artificial neural networks, to develop efficient models for structural evaluation and optimization. He investigates soil-structure interaction phenomena, pile foundation behavior in non-homogeneous soils, and the seismic response of large offshore wind turbines. His research bridges civil engineering, renewable energy, and computational science to address challenges in sustainable energy infrastructure.
His publication record demonstrates a consistent focus on applying artificial neural networks to solve complex structural engineering problems related to offshore wind energy. The research shows progression from fundamental structural analysis (2017) to sophisticated computational models incorporating soil-structure interaction (2021-2025). Recent work emphasizes optimization techniques like PSO and global sensitivity analysis for jacket substructures, reflecting the field's evolution toward more comprehensive and efficient design methodologies for offshore wind infrastructure.
Dr. Quevedo Reina maintains strong collaborative relationships with Guillermo Manuel Álamo Meneses, Juan José Aznárez González, and Luis Alberto Padrón Hernández, among others. His work appears consistently in high-impact Q1 journals including Ocean Engineering, Engineering Structures, and Computers & Structures, demonstrating the significance and quality of his research contributions to the field of offshore wind energy infrastructure.
